无法注入角度cookie - 未知的提供程序错误

时间:2016-10-28 21:21:24

标签: angularjs cookies

在我的基本控制器中,我添加了ngCookies

  

var app = angular.module(" MyApp",[" ui.router"," ngCookies"]);

然后在我处理登录的Login控制器中:

(function () {
    angular.module("MyApp").controller("LoginCtrl", ["$scope", "$state", "$http", "$cookies", MyLogin]);

    function MyLogin($scope, $state, $http, $cookies) {

    }

})();

现在我收到了一个错误:

  

错误:[$ injector:unpr]未知提供商:$ cookiesProvider< - $ cookies< - LoginCtrl

我为angular-cookies.min.js

设置了引用
<script type="text/javascript" src="Scripts/angular.js"></script>
<script type="text/javascript" src="Scripts/angular-cookies.min.js"</script>

1 个答案:

答案 0 :(得分:0)

也许您对脚本引用有一些问题,因为正如您在this jsbin中看到的那样,一切都运行良好。

调试你的html代码,看看它是否正确包含了angular-cookies库;)